Discrete Pigeon Inspired Simulated Annealing Algorithm and Contract Net Algorithm based on Multi-objective Optimization for Task Allocation of UAV Formation
Xuzan Liu, Yu Han, Yu Han, Jian Chen, Yi Cao, Shubo Wang
2020
Abstract
In this paper, a mathematical model of multi-objective optimization under complex constraints is established to solve the task allocation problem. Among them, the constraint indexes include UAV quantity constraint and fuel consumption constraint; the optimization objectives include the gain, loss and fuel consumption. Discrete Pigeon Inspired Optimization-Simulated Annealing (DPIO-SA) algorithm is proposed to solve this problem. The experimental results show that while the total fitness reaches the optimum, the gain is the largest, the loss and fuel consumption are the smallest. After running the algorithm 30 times. The number of times that DPIO-SA reaches the global optimum is 15, while DPIO is 2. In addition, the average value of DPIO-SA after stabilization is 13.5% larger than that of DPIO. Both prove that after joining SA, the algorithm is easier to reach the global extremum. The Contract Net Algorithm (CNA) is adopted to solve the task scheduling problem. The UAVs are divided into tenderer UAV, potential bidder UAVs, bidder UAVs and winner UAV. After network communication, suitable bidder UAV is found to replace tenderer UAV to perform the task. Experimental results show that the algorithm has good applicability.
DownloadPaper Citation
in Harvard Style
Liu X., Han Y., Chen J., Cao Y. and Wang S. (2020). Discrete Pigeon Inspired Simulated Annealing Algorithm and Contract Net Algorithm based on Multi-objective Optimization for Task Allocation of UAV Formation. In Proceedings of the 12th International Joint Conference on Computational Intelligence (IJCCI 2020) - Volume 1: ECTA; ISBN 978-989-758-475-6, SciTePress, pages 176-183. DOI: 10.5220/0010106401760183
in Bibtex Style
@conference{ecta20,
author={Xuzan Liu and Yu Han and Jian Chen and Yi Cao and Shubo Wang},
title={Discrete Pigeon Inspired Simulated Annealing Algorithm and Contract Net Algorithm based on Multi-objective Optimization for Task Allocation of UAV Formation},
booktitle={Proceedings of the 12th International Joint Conference on Computational Intelligence (IJCCI 2020) - Volume 1: ECTA},
year={2020},
pages={176-183},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0010106401760183},
isbn={978-989-758-475-6},
}
in EndNote Style
TY - CONF
JO - Proceedings of the 12th International Joint Conference on Computational Intelligence (IJCCI 2020) - Volume 1: ECTA
TI - Discrete Pigeon Inspired Simulated Annealing Algorithm and Contract Net Algorithm based on Multi-objective Optimization for Task Allocation of UAV Formation
SN - 978-989-758-475-6
AU - Liu X.
AU - Han Y.
AU - Chen J.
AU - Cao Y.
AU - Wang S.
PY - 2020
SP - 176
EP - 183
DO - 10.5220/0010106401760183
PB - SciTePress